APC Raises the Alarm over ‘Planned Sponsored Protests’ in Edo

Ogochukwu Isioma by Ogochukwu Isioma
March 26, 2025
0 0
0

By Ogochukwu Isioma

The ruling All Progressives Congress (APC) in Edo State has raised the alarm over alleged plans by individuals to stage sponsored protests in different parts of the state this week.

The party claims that the demonstrations are not genuine expressions of public concern but are being orchestrated by certain individuals and leaders within the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) to disrupt the state’s peace and stability.

In a statement on Wednesday signed by its Chairman, Jarret Tenebe, the Edo APC expressed concerns about “a pattern of misinformation and deliberate falsehoods” being circulated ahead of the planned protests.

The party warned that these activities are intended to incite unrest and undermine the progress achieved since Senator Monday Okpebholo assumed office as the Governor of Edo State.

“I wish to unequivocally state that Governor Okpebholo respects the fundamental rights of citizens to peaceful assembly and expression of grievances, as enshrined in the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ria,” Tenebe said.

“However, we have observed a pattern of misinformation and deliberate falsehoods being circulated in the lead-up to these planned demonstrations.

“These patterns suggest that the intention is not to engage in constructive dialogue or to highlight legitimate issues, but rather to sow discord, incite unrest, and undermine the progress Edo State has been making since Senator Monday Okpebholo assumed office as the Governor of Edo State,” the statement addd.

The APC chairman claimed that the party has identified individuals and groups allegedly behind the planned protests, insisting that their goal is to create unnecessary tension and potentially trigger a breakdown of law and order.

The party, however, urged citizens to remain vigilant and to avoid participating in the demonstrations. Tenebe reaffirmed APC’s commitment to addressing legitimate concerns through established governmental channels.

“The APC urges all law-abiding citizens to be vigilant and to distance themselves from these sponsored protests. We understand that genuine concerns may exist within our society, and we remain committed to addressing these through legitimate channels of communication and engagement.

“We encourage anyone with genuine grievances to approach the appropriate Government agencies for dialogue and resolution. The APC urges the good people of Edo State that the administration of Governor Okpebholo is fully prepared to ensure the safety and security of all residents,” the statement added.

The ruling party revealed that, following “credible intelligence” on the planned protests, law enforcement agencies in the state have been placed on high alert to prevent any potential disorder.

“We will not allow any individual or group, regardless of their motives, to disrupt the peace and progress of Edo State,” the statement warned.

“Law enforcement agencies have been told to be on high alert and will take all necessary measures within the ambit of the law to prevent any breakdown of order and to protect lives and property.”

The APC, therefore, called on parents, guardians, community leaders and stakeholders to advise their wards and members to refrain from participating n the said protests.

“Do not allow yourselves to be used as pawns in the hands of those who seek to destabilize our State for their own selfish ends,” the party warned.

“The State APC remains focused on supporting the Okpebholo administration in delivering good governance, implementing people-oriented policies, and fostering sustainable development across the State. We will not be distracted by the divisive tactics of a few individuals.

“We urge all citizens to remain calm, go about their lawful businesses, and continue to support the efforts of the Government in building a prosperous and peaceful Edo State for all,” the statement concluded.
